Output 5869e712086822111d2fecba788cb53ffe9ce9d5f1a642839d159d0f84147987:1

value
29270981
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 06f98f407a6bc0955e08977b83627548b5409662 OP_EQUALVERIFY OP_CHECKSIG
address
1dt1rZGeCDMcwr4sho9UopTV7qmnEHZwc
transaction
5869e712086822111d2fecba788cb53ffe9ce9d5f1a642839d159d0f84147987
spent
true